Concorde Asset Management LLC Decreases Stock Holdings in U.S. Bancorp (NYSE:USB)

Concorde Asset Management LLC cut its stake in U.S. Bancorp (NYSE:USBFree Report) by 7.2%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 7,014 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 541 shares during the period. Concorde Asset Management LLC’s holdings in U.S. Bancorp were worth $335,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

U.S. Bancorp Stock Performance

NYSE:USB opened at $37.22 on Friday. The firm’s fifty day simple moving average is $43.65 and its 200 day simple moving average is $47.07. The company has a current ratio of 0.81, a quick ratio of 0.80 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.11. U.S. Bancorp has a twelve month low of $35.18 and a twelve month high of $53.98. The firm has a market capitalization of $57.99 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 9.82, a PEG ratio of 1.73 and a beta of 0.91.

U.S. Bancorp (NYSE:USBG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, January 16th. The financial services provider reported $1.07 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.06 by $0.01. U.S. Bancorp had a return on equity of 12.94% and a net margin of 14.75%. The company had revenue of $7.01 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$7 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$0.99 earnings per share.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 3.7%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ities research analysts expect that U.S. Bancorp will post 4.38 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

U.S. Bancorp Announces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, April 15th. Stockholders of record on Monday, March 31st will be paid a dividend of $0.50 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, March 31st. This represents a $2.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 5.37%. U.S. Bancorp’s dividend payout ratio is currently 52.77%.

About U.S. Bancorp

(Free Report)

U.S. Bancorp, a financial services holding company, provides various financial services to individuals, businesses, institutional organizations, governmental entities, and other financial institutions in the United States. It operates through Wealth, Corporate, Commercial and Institutional Banking; Consumer and Business Banking; Payment Services; and Treasury and Corporate Support segments.
